Output fba223bccb6957c183db4725e84ae0190d71472973627eacf44bdcb563cdc7c1:17

value
28100000
script pubkey
OP_0 OP_PUSHBYTES_20 c5ce11dcaf00fcd1849f1f75c10f8d3144f0acbe
address
ltc1qch8prh90qr7drpylra6uzrudx9z0pt97rf43mf
transaction
fba223bccb6957c183db4725e84ae0190d71472973627eacf44bdcb563cdc7c1
spent
true